Crunchgear has a nice post up on the new Skullcandy iPhone FMJ headphones – dubbed their ‘crown jewel of Macworld’, and getting shown off in the picture above. These seem to have gained quite a few admirers at both CES and Macworld this year.

Here’s some of the details from Skullcandy’s site on the new FMJs:

Think FMJ audio superiority with a new tightly-wrapped, coiled metal cable, plus the addition of a sleek in-line mic. That’s right, Skullcandy’s iPhone FMJ lets you and your iPhone rock together AND talk together.

  • 11mm speaker
  • Frequency range: 16 Hz 20K Hz
  • Impedance: 16 ohms
  • Max input power: 500mW
  • Cable type: Aluminum foil
  • Cable length: 1.1 M
  • Plug type: 3.5mm gold plated
  • Accessories:
  • EVA carrying case
  • COMPLY foam tips

The iPhone FMJs go for $79.95.  Unfortunately, these are showing as out of stock until February 1st right now.  You can go get a better look and see what you think right now though, at Skullcandy’s page:
